Output 68c64c8530613d433582ad0b206490cb84d0ae430d0e8bdc0361a816ec38d3b9:8
- value
- 10209156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ba24ce3c77317e37eaee75b8b6311ecddabffba9 OP_EQUAL
- address
- 3JfFhXH5HjKmxJSK8A7wis65s4g3pNEGru
- transaction
- 68c64c8530613d433582ad0b206490cb84d0ae430d0e8bdc0361a816ec38d3b9
- spent
- true